JC Land Day - Tuesday



Yesterday - was JC Land Day - and the kids loved it.
It all started in the morning after flag time when it was announced that all leaders and staff were prisoners in JC land and that all kids were allowed to tell the prisoners what they should do or not do.

The prisoners were only allowed to use one hand during the whole day - so one hand was fixed behind the back with a small string.

The kids were really good at handling this new status and gave us all lots to do.
It started of with the cleaning - 20 leaders and staff cleaned the whole school and much more....It has never been so clean. The kids really enjoyed their new status.

During the day the kids were split in groups where they were asked to work as a team. Their task was to create a country of their own with flag, dances, language, rules, songs, etc. A fantacy land.

Each team had a prisoner and the 3rd activity was a session where each prisoner was dressed up and face pained and stuff and each team had to protect their prisoner form other teams who might want to throw water at the prisoner - this of causes ended up in a water fight - with lots of laughter and fun.

For dinner the JC land team had arranged a very special barbeque outdoor - Hot dogs the danish let's hygge village way.....yummi.

The last session of this great day was where each team went on stage in front of the whole village in order to present their fantacy land to all of us. This went very well and all kids participated and had fun.

Then the JC land train took us to the Hygge room where a few sketches were performed and the finale was the famous "milkshake".....yummi (Jos!)

After that we ended the day with a JC land Disco (in order to get the kids to get closer - even boys and girls holding hands while dancing)....and after a great day at Hygge land the kids were in bed at 23.00.
